What families actually pay

Family incomeNet price per year
Under $30k$15,904
$30k to $48k$16,580
$48k to $75k$21,157
$75k to $110k$25,067
$110k and up$29,031
All families (average)$22,585

Net price is the yearly cost after grants and scholarships, by family income (College Scorecard). Credit: TuitionTracker.
